There are increasing demands on the skill set of a researcher in Europe. Today, acquisition of third-party funding and well structured management belong to the repertoire of a researcher just as well as his subject-specific knowledge. Successful researchers are those who are able to get their knowledge financed, organised efficiently, and applied in a targeted manner.

The financing of research is of particular interest: Where can funds for R&D be acquired and how does a researcher write a successful research proposal? In addition, a proposal has higher chances of success, if it is written according to standards in project management. This is especially true in case of a proposal for the 7th Framework Programme of the European Union (FP7). But also with SNSF and CTI evaluators a professionally written proposal has higher chances of success.

Tailored to the needs of modern researchers, EUrelations AG offers several trainings:
